Hello Suresh Kumar,
You must acknowledge the interrupt in your interrupt service routine.
The following code runs on a Keil evaluation board MCB2300 and toggles the LEDs P2.0, P2.1 with 1Hz.
/* Timer0 IRQ: Executed periodically */ __irq void T0_IRQHandler (void) { volatile unsigned int pin_status = FIO2PIN; if (pin_status & (1 << 0)) FIO2CLR = (1 << 0); /* LED off */ else FIO2SET = (1 << 0); /* LED on */ T0IR = 1; /* Clear interrupt flag */ VICVectAddr = 0; /* Acknowledge Interrupt */ } /* Timer1 IRQ: Executed periodically */ __irq void T1_IRQHandler (void) { volatile unsigned int pin_status = FIO2PIN; if (pin_status & (1 << 1)) FIO2CLR = (1 << 1); /* LED off */ else FIO2SET = (1 << 1); /* LED on */ T1IR = 1; /* Clear interrupt flag */ VICVectAddr = 0; /* Acknowledge Interrupt */ } int main (void) { PINSEL10 = 0; /* Disable ETM interface, enable LEDs */ FIO2DIR = 0x000000FF; /* P2.0..7 defined as Outputs */ FIO2MASK = 0x00000000; /* Enable and setup timer interrupt, start timer */ T0MR0 = 11999999; /* 1sec = 12000000-1 @ 12.0 MHz*/ T0MCR = 3; /* Interrupt and Reset on MR0 */ T0TCR = 1; /* Timer0 Enable */ VICVectAddr4 = (unsigned long)T0_IRQHandler;/* Set Interrupt Vector */ VICVectCntl4 = 15; /* use it for Timer0 Interrupt */ VICIntEnable = (1 << 4); /* Enable Timer0 Interrupt */ /* Enable and setup timer interrupt, start timer */ T1MR0 = 11999999; /* 1sec = 12000000-1 @ 12.0 MHz*/ T1MCR = 3; /* Interrupt and Reset on MR1 */ T1TCR = 1; /* Timer0 Enable */ VICVectAddr5 = (unsigned long)T1_IRQHandler;/* Set Interrupt Vector */ VICVectCntl5 = 15; /* use it for Timer0 Interrupt */ VICIntEnable = (1 << 5); /* Enable Timer0 Interrupt */ while (1); /* Loop forever */ }
